Walsh N et al. - The use of hepatitis C surveillance system has been successful in identifying cases of newly acquired hepatitis C which are often difficult to identify in a clinical setting. In addition, marginalized patients who may otherwise never have been referred to a clinic are able to access hepatitis C treatment and specialist services. Despite this, only eight out of 87 eligible individuals (9%) began acute hepatitis C treatment.
